On Jan 28, 10:58am, okamoto@granite.cias.osakafu-u.ac.jp wrote:
> Subject: [9fans] What about panel library in the next release?
> I'm now looking into Panel library of Plan 9, and found there is no
> horizontal scrollbar in the present release.  I've also heard here that
graphics
> models will be changed in the next release...  So, I'd like to know the
> future of panel library whether I should be with that or not.

A scroll bar created with PACKN or PACKS in the flags will be
horizontal.  But nobody supports the panel library and it was
definitely in a beta state on the distribution, so I'd
be leery of using it for anything compilicated.

Thanks Tom--

Actually I tried to test your scrltest.c in /sys/src/libpanel to make use of 
horizontal scrollbar for item list.  

>A scroll bar created with PACKN or PACKS in the flags will be horizontal.  

Yes, scrollbar itself can be made horizontal, but the pllist() does not support 
horizontal scrolling.  :-)  If we confine ourselves only to this program, 
horizontal list might not be neccessary for most of applications, however...
